When the pvalue is less than a predetermined significance level default is 5% or 0. Steffensens method also achieves quadratic convergence, but without using derivatives as newtons method does. Steffensens method steffensen method technology trends. For example, the ftest for smoker tests whether the coefficient of the indicator variable for smoker is different from zero. Help with the steffensens method in matlab not using. Thanks for contributing an answer to mathematics stack exchange. It is named after alexander aitkin, who introduced this method in 1926. Derivation usingaitkens deltasquared process implemented in the matlab can be found using the aitkens deltasquared process for accelerating convergence of a sequence. That is, the ftest determines whether being a smoker has a significant effect on bloodpressure. In this post, ill talk about aitkens method and how one can cook up examples that not only. I have implemented the following code of the steffensens method but with out using the implementation of the aitken s delta squared process. Halleys method for square roots mathematics stack exchange. On single roots, the method has a convergence of order approximately.
This method assumes starting with a linearly convergent sequence and increases the rate of convergence of that sequence. Vector aitkens deltasquare accelerator file exchange matlab. Steffensens method in matlab with out using the aitkens process. How to compute rsquared value matlab answers matlab. Fsi, aitkens delta squared method, steepestdescent method, regression based neural network. The result h is 1 if the test rejects the null hypothesis at the 5% significance level, and 0 otherwise. Simple description, advantages and drawbacks, derivation using aitkens deltasquared process, implementation in matlab, generalization.
The problem is that now, i need to elevate each value of x to square, and so, obtain a new vector, lets say y, that will contain the values of x squared. Mathworks logo, part three, pde toolbox matlab central blogs. An augmented iterative method for identifying a stressfree reference. Aitkens interpolation aitkens procedure yields systematically and successively better interpolation polynomials corresponding to successively higher order truncation of newtons divided difference formula. Msd is defined as msdaveragertr02 where rt is the position of the particle at time t and r0 is the initial position, so in a sense it is. Since the original algorithm may suffer by a numerical instability, it can be stabilized by employing a builtin weighing function fw depending on the current order of iteration. Well use data collected to study water pollution caused by industrial and domestic waste. The solution may be reached by the ironstuck version of the aitkens deltasquare process. The task was to simulate the behavior of fluid filled in a container with only the top boundary lid moving at a certain velocity. Based on your location, we recommend that you select. Given a set of x and corresponding fx, estimate f1x1 f1 aitkenx,f,x1 f corresponding function of x f1 corresponding function of x1.
The secant method can be thought of as a finitedifference approximation of newtons method. You typically need to use responsevar when fitting a table or dataset array tbl. Use a vector n 0,1,2,3 to specify the order of derivatives. Aitken s interpolation aitken s procedure yields systematically and successively better interpolation polynomials corresponding to successively higher order truncation of newtons divided difference formula. I am new to matlab i have implemented the following code of the steffensens method but with out using the implementation of the aitkens deltasquared process. This text introduces the reader to a wide range of numerical algorithms, while it explains the fundamental principles and illustrates the applications of those algorithms. The following matlab project contains the source code and matlab examples used for newtons method for divided differences. Im trying to solve this problem in my numerical analysis class using matlab. In addition, i provide software written in matlab to compute the gmm standard errors of the correlation coe cient between two random ariablesv and the ratio of standard deviations of two random ariables. You would get faster convergence with any of aitkens deltasquared process, regula falsi in the illinois variant, newtons method or any other superlinear method. The larger the rsquared is, the more variability is explained by the linear regression model. Aitken interpolation method commatlabcentralfileexchange33175aitkeninterpolationmethod, matlab. I have implemented the following code of the steffensens method but with out using the implementation of the aitkens deltasquared process.
Aitkens deltasquared process projects and source code. The source code and files included in this project are listed in the project files section, please make sure whether the listed source code meet your needs there. Not recommended create linear regression model matlab. In numerical analysis, aitkins deltasquared process is a series acceleration method, used for accelerating the rate of convergence of a sequence. Calculating meansquared displacement msd with matlab. This display decomposes the anova table into the model terms. To use random, specify the probability distribution name and its parameters. The correlation coefficient and the rsquared value are not the same.
Coefficient of determination rsquared indicates the proportionate amount of variation in the response variable y explained by the independent variables x in the linear regression model. The following matlab project contains the source code and matlab examples used for aitken interpolation method. To compare the following formulae to the formulae in the section above, notice that x n p. What i want to do is to calculate the meansquared displacement for the particle using the xyz coordinates for all time steps.
Demonstrating aitkens sequence acceleration college. The following matlab project contains the source code and matlab examples used for vector aitkens delta square accelerator. More than 40 million people use github to discover, fork, and contribute to over 100 million projects. Aitken delta squar method file exchange matlab central. It combines the basic newton algorithm with an aitken deltasquared acceleration. It is perhaps not surprising that one of the primary examples involves the lshaped membrane. Dirac delta function matlab dirac mathworks italia. See the statistics and machine learning toolbox documentation for interpret linear regression results for a discussion of the rsquared statistic in the context of linear regression. You would have to post your data that it seems are aat and qerot1 to allow us to comment further on whether a high correlation is appropriate. Response variable to use in the fit, specified as the commaseparated pair consisting of responsevar and either a character vector or string scalar containing the variable name in the table or dataset array tbl, or a logical or numeric index vector indicating which column is the response variable. Choose a web site to get translated content where available and see local events and offers. Aitken interpolation method file exchange matlab central. To use pdf, specify the probability distribution name and its parameters.
In numerical analysis, the secant method is a rootfinding algorithm that uses a succession of roots of secant lines to better approximate a root of a function f. A slight variation of this method, called ste ensens method, can be used to accelerate the convergence of fixedpoint iteration, which, as previously discussed, is linearly convergent. Im a computer engineering student and i have a design problem. The partial differential equation toolbox contains tools for the analysis of pdes in two space dimensions and time. Aitkens method indian institute of technology madras. The regress function can calculate the rsquared value. Statistics and machine learning toolbox also offers the generic function random, which supports various probability distributions. Matlab software for numerical methods and analysis matlab software packages for numerical methods. Im trying to write a function ssd that takes two m x 1 vectors and calculates the sum of squared differences im testing my ssd function with the vectors. Statistics and machine learning toolbox also offers the generic function pdf, which supports various probability distributions. Accelerating convergence university of southern mississippi. The following matlab project contains the source code and matlab examples used for vector aitken s delta square accelerator.
Posts about aitken deltasquared process written by collegemathteaching. I am new to matlab i have implemented the following code of the steffensens method but with out using the implementation of the aitken s delta squared process. Dirac delta function matlab dirac mathworks deutschland. The extrapolated partial sum is given by see also eulers series transformation. F distribution the f distribution is a twoparameter distribution that has parameters. The corresponding fstatistics in the f column assess the statistical significance of each term.
Note that the distributionspecific function chi2rnd is faster than the generic function random. Standard errors using the delta method and gmm constantino hevia january, 2008. The alternative hypothesis is that the data does not come from such a distribution. Given a set of x and corresponding fx, estimate f1x1 f1 aitken x,f,x1 f corresponding function of x f1 corresponding function of x1. Aitkens delta process to find roots in matlab youtube. This mfile solves nonlinear schrodinger equation and display the results in 3d graphics along with it the pulse broadening ratio and phase shift has also been calculated and displayed. Hunter, statistics for experimenters wiley, 1978, pp. Chisquare probability density function matlab chi2pdf. Let the result of an iterative process be a vector. Compute the dirac delta function of x and its first three derivatives. Id like to be able to use a numerical method to find the square root of a number with only logic gates on a physical hardware level and im restricted to binary numbers. Steffensens method in matlab with out using the aitken s process.
Matlab software for numerical methods and analysis matlab software packages for. How to square each element of a vector matlab answers. Aitken interpolation method in matlab download free open. It is also known as newtons method, and is considered as limiting case of secant method based on the first few terms of taylors series, newtonraphson method is more used when the first derivation of the given functionequation is a large value. How to obtain r square value matlab answers matlab central.
1208 90 368 10 111 959 1381 1098 706 264 109 332 895 770 757 601 1460 1277 1212 843 1404 273 542 520 159 1373 289 227 144 222 313 261 984 823